Trial Title Digital Mental Health -- Evidence from Mexico Digital Mental Health Care -- Evidence from Mexico
Abstract We study the uptake and impacts of an AI-driven mental health phone application on psychological wellbeing and related outcomes among low-income women in Mexico. We study the uptake and impacts of an AI-driven mental health phone application on psychological wellbeing and related outcomes among low to medium-income women in Mexico experiencing psychological distress.
Trial End Date December 24, 2025 December 31, 2025
Last Published May 20, 2025 02:35 PM November 02, 2025 03:54 PM
Intervention End Date September 24, 2025 November 15, 2025
Experimental Design (Public) We select 4000 low-income Mexican women and randomly offer premium access to an AI-driven mental health app to half of them. We measure outcomes at baseline, 3 and 6 weeks later. A sample of Mexican women with psychological distress was randomly offer premium access to an AI-driven mental health app. We measure outcomes at baseline, 3-4, 7-8 weeks and 6 months later.
Planned Number of Observations 4000 Approximately 2,000 women
Sample size (or number of clusters) by treatment arms 2000 Approximately 1,000 per treatment arm
